🍷 Wine & Cheese Pairings to Savor 🧀
🥂 Alta Alella Mirgin & Mahón
A crisp, elegant Cava paired with the buttery, slightly tangy Mahón cheese from Menorca. A match made in Mediterranean heaven.
🍇 Siah & Cabrales
This bold, expressive wine is the perfect partner for Cabrales, the famed blue cheese from Asturias. Expect an explosion of flavor as the rich, intense cheese meets deep, structured tannins.
🌸 Grand Nord Rosé & Tetilla
A fresh and aromatic rosé that brings out the delicate nutty notes of Tetilla, a smooth and creamy cheese from Galicia.
🍷 Villota Tinto & Manchego
This Rioja beauty shines alongside the legendary Manchego, the king of Spanish cheeses, aged to perfection for a nutty, caramelized depth that complements the wine’s velvety tannins.
🍷 Pago de La Posada & Zamorano
A complex, full-bodied red from Toro, masterfully paired with Zamorano, a robust and aged sheep’s milk cheese that echoes the wine’s intensity.
